Usar DescribeDocumentPermission com uma CLI - Exemplos de código do AWS SDK

Há mais exemplos do AWS SDK disponíveis no repositório do GitHub Documento de Exemplos do AWS SDK.

Usar DescribeDocumentPermission com uma CLI

Os exemplos de código a seguir mostram como usar o DescribeDocumentPermission.

CLI
AWS CLI

Para descrever permissões do documento

O exemplo de describe-document-permission a seguir exibe detalhes de permissão sobre um documento do Systems Manager que é compartilhado publicamente.

aws ssm describe-document-permission \ --name "Example" \ --permission-type "Share"

Saída:

{ "AccountIds": [ "all" ], "AccountSharingInfoList": [ { "AccountId": "all", "SharedDocumentVersion": "$DEFAULT" } ] }

Para obter mais informações, consulte Compartilhar um documento do Systems Manager no Guia do usuário do AWS Systems Manager.

PowerShell
Ferramentas para PowerShell V4

Exemplo 1: esse exemplo lista todas as versões de um documento.

Get-SSMDocumentVersionList -Name "RunShellScript"

Saída:

CreatedDate DocumentVersion IsDefaultVersion Name ----------- --------------- ---------------- ---- 2/24/2017 5:25:13 AM 1 True RunShellScript
Ferramentas para PowerShell V5

Exemplo 1: esse exemplo lista todas as versões de um documento.

Get-SSMDocumentVersionList -Name "RunShellScript"

Saída:

CreatedDate DocumentVersion IsDefaultVersion Name ----------- --------------- ---------------- ---- 2/24/2017 5:25:13 AM 1 True RunShellScript